520 |a New technologies, for example, telerehabilitation (TR) tools, can support physiotherapists' work. Even though studies have demonstrated their potential, TR is not yet fully implemented in Austrian outpatient physiotherapy. As a result of the Coronavirus pandemic and the associated lockdowns, physiotherapists in Austria were confronted with the challenge of offering therapies without physical contact. This study aims to investigate opinions and experiences of physiotherapists in Austria regarding TR and its implementation in different clinical fields.
